Patriots Draft LB Mayo

Sunday, April 27th, 2008

The 10th player picked in Saturday’s NFL draft can still be a contributor to one of the best teams instead of a cornerstone of a rebuilding project. And with New England’s linebacker corps having at least three players who will be 31 or older when the season starts, he may not have to wait many [...]
